We purchased a clock blithfield compact 5 and had it fitted by a local professional fitter in Essex. We had the chimney lined and fireplace chopped out to provide a slightly bigger chamber for it to sit in. The stove itself feels very well made and built to last. Its performance is excellent and we have had no issues with smoke billowing in the room or any issues around it making too much noise. It is quiet, efficient and provides a supreme level of heat. The controls on it are very precise and a joy to use...From talking to our fitter he advised that stoves will behave differently depending on how that are used (or not used correctly) and where geographically they are fitted. We have a very tall chimney and live in an area that is not to built up. Our clock stove is frankly the best investment we made and we absolutely love it. If you are thinking of getting a stove fitted I would recommend you get a survey first and proper advice on it''s installation, how to light it, control it etc. It could be the best decision you ever made.
